VivoSim Labs, Inc. (NASDAQ:VIVS), (the "Company" or "VivoSim"), a provider of next-generation New Approach Methodologies (NAMs) for preclinical safety, today announced the pricing of up to a $4 million best-efforts public offering, with $3 million funded at an initial closing of the offering (the "Initial Closing") and another $1 million to be funded on the 30th day following the date of the Initial Closing, subject to the satisfaction of certain conditions (the "Second Closing"). The Initial Closing of the offering is expected to occur on, April 1, 2026, subject to the satisfaction of customary closing conditions.

The Initial Closing of the public offering consists of the issuance and sale of $3 million in common stock (or pre-funded warrants in lieu of common stock), at a subscription price of $1.140 per share, and $1.139 per prefunded warrant), representing 286,557 common shares and 2,345,022 pre-funded warrants. Additionally, the Company will issue 3,947,369 common warrants to purchase up to 150% of the aggregate number of shares of common stock (or pre-funded warrants) sold at the Initial Closing. Such common warrants will have an exercise price of $1.710 per share, will be immediately exercisable, and will expire five years from their date of issuance. The prefunded warrants will have an exercise price of $0.001 per prefunded warrant share, will be immediately exercisable, and will expire when exercised in full. The Second Closing will consist of the issuance and sale of an additional $1 million in common stock (or pre-funded warrant in lieu of common stock) and common warrants to purchase up to 150% of the aggregate number of shares of common stock (or pre-funded warrants) sold at the Second Closing. The Second Closing is subject to the satisfaction of certain conditions, including conditions related to minimum closing price and average trading volume. The subscription of the offering is led by a New York-based single family office.

Joseph Gunnar & Co., LLC is serving as the exclusive placement agent in connection with the offering.
